Year-long celebrations as Radio 4 turns 40

Hong Kong’s classical music and fine arts station has launched a special website to help celebrate its 40th birthday.

The site, http://app4.rthk.hk/special/r440/index.phpaims to give listeners insights into more than a dozen events planned to mark the occasion.

Launched in 1974 by public broadcaster RTHK,  Radio 4 broadcasts western classical, jazz, world, Chinese, and contemporary music and also features concert recordings, studio concerts, educational programmes and arts news.

Here are some of the event highlights:

June: New Generation Concerts / Match-making Concerts (featuring works by HK composers)

September: Music DJ @ Schools & Moonlight Serenade (a concert to celebrate also the Mid Autumn Festival)

October: RTHK Quartet 5th Anniversary Concert

November: Music Beyond Borders at New Vision Arts Festival

December: 40th Anniversary Concert & Christmas Concert in the Park (closing event).
